Driver Insights
The Ford Everest 2012 is widely regarded as a practical SUV for buyers who prioritise durability. Based on feedback from Sri Lankan drivers, the Everest performs well in rough road environments and long-distance travel.
Local drivers describe the Toyota C-HR 2018 as smooth, quiet, and stress-free to drive in daily traffic. The hybrid system switches seamlessly between electric and petrol power, especially at low speeds, which suits Colombo commuting well.
